When was Blackline Sundown released?


Blackline Sundown is first released on April 08, 2011 as part of Rev 16:8's album "Ashlands" which includes 10 tracks in total. This song is the 2nd track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Blackline Sundown?


Blackline Sundown falls under the genre Rock.
✔️

How long is the song Blackline Sundown?


Blackline Sundown song length is 3 minutes and 02 seconds.
